As you want to get into banking sector and you have a graduation degree in commerce you can straight away start your career by applying to executive level jobs in banking sector. You could work in a variety of areas in banking industry such as a customer service, front desk, cash handling, Account opening, Banking officer, probationary officer (for which you need sit for various Entrance Examinations conducted by banks), loan officer, assessor, mortgage loan underwriter, loan processing officer, accountant, product marketing and sales executive, recovery officer etc.
